No. No way.
That can't be him.
He's human.
Human... right?
Not a massive grisly skull.
But it sounds like him. His voice.
It was him. No way.
what happened to you?
As the digidemon stared in complete astonishment and dubiety, the man in front of him seemed to also grow shocked. The sharp yellow eyes underneath the bony head seemed to glow brighter.
In the other man's extending train of thought, a prominent rail of memories stuck out like a sore thumb. Even after a long year, he could recognise the musician's voice. A voice he used to pine for ever since he went missing before eventually losing all hope of reunion.
"Agoti?"
Then, in a swift motion, the skull crackled away, exposing the ever-familiar face. Blond fluffy hair that fell over one side of his head, pale skin stretched over a thin face. The widened eyes retained their yellow tint with pitch-black sclera, yet they kept glowing in the dark.
Agoti stepped back, raising a trembling hand to his mouth. It was him.
Tabi.
-
Agoti's fingers impatiently tapped on the wooden table, synchronized with the analog clock's endless ticking as it counted down to 1:00AM. A mixture of different emotions were congregating in his chest, fusing and pulling apart. The most prominent ones were a strange type of relief and unadulterated worry.
